I'm looking for a phone case for my iPhone 5S. The problem is, to listen to music in my car I need to plug it in, and the part of the cable that touches the base of the phone is large enough that it isn't compatible with many phone cases. Here's a picture of the phone plugged in, and a picture of what the current case covers.

You may note some problems with the current case; I'd like to find one that's sturdier (and prettier would also be a bonus) but has an open base so that I don't have to take it off to plug in my phone. Any suggestions would be welcome, thank you very much!

The cheap adapter that aubilenon links to has some question/answers that say it will not handle data, just power. Some of the reviews do mention audio working, though. You need to make sure any adapter you buy will handle both data and power. Or else, can you replace the cord with a lightning version?

Give up on adaptors. The 3 foot long Amazon Basics Lightning-USB cable is two bucks cheaper than the adaptor aubilenon links to.

If you'd rather not patronize Amazon, there are still a lot of options in the sub-$10 range (Monoprice is good and even cheaper, but shipping will cost more). Just make sure it's got MFI certification; very few of the extremely cheap cables are.

Once you have that, you can use any case that strikes your fancy, and they will also be able to provide more coverage around the periphery your phone. There is no downside.
